Pre-sale tickets for the ASA STARS National Tour Tar Heel 250 at Hickory Motor Speedway will go on sale this Friday, April 14.

Advanced adult general admission prices for the Thursday, May 25 event will be $25.00. Kids 6-12 will be $10.00 and kids five and under will be free. Advanced tickets for active and retired military members will be $20.00, a $10 discount when bought in advance.

The Tar Heel 250 is right in the middle of “Speedweek” in the Charlotte-metro area of North Carolina. Millbridge Speedway, in Salisbury, NC, features the Extreme Outlaw Midget Series on Tuesday and Wednesday. Thursday will see the Tar Heel 250 – Thursday Thunder in the Foothills at Hickory Motor Speedway for the ASA STARS National Tour. Saturday brings CARS Tour action for Late Model Stock Cars at Tri-County Speedway in Hudson, NC. To cap the week off, there will be two days of NASCAR action at Charlotte Motor Speedway, with the Coca-Cola 600 culminating the week on Sunday.

ASA STARS National Tour
The ASA STARS National Tour debuted in March of 2023 for Super Late Model racing in America. Announced last October, many of the best drivers in America will compete in the ten-race national tour with a minimum $100,000 point fund. The championship team will be guaranteed $25,000.

The ASA STARS National Tour is made up of three races from each of the regional pavement Super Late Model Series under the Track Enterprises banner; the ASA CRA Super Series, the ASA Midwest Tour and the ASA Southern Super Series.

The Team Construction Winner’s Circle program has been announced as a part of the ASA STARS National Tour for licensed drivers/teams with perfect attendance. The program provides additional financial incentives to those teams who support the Series, thanks to Team Construction.

Track Enterprises, a Racing Promotions Company based in Illinois, will operate the ASA STARS National Tour. It announced the acquisition of the CRA sanctioning body in January and followed that up with the purchase of the Midwest Tour in July. In October, Track Enterprises President, Bob Sargent announced a partnership with the Southern Super Series which set the table for the formation of the ASA STARS National Tour.
